Trade and Export Information - Dileeparun Impex Pvt Ltd
India exports the listed categories to a wide set of regions. Fresh apples and dragon fruit are frequently shipped to the Middle East, Southeast Asia and the European Union, often in refrigerated containers with temperature control between 0 °C and 4 °C. Ginger, garlic and other spices flow to the United States and EU under HS 0709, usually requiring a phytosanitary certificate and compliance with maximum pesticide residue limits. Basmati rice, basmati varieties and wheat are major Indian exports to the Gulf Cooperation Council, Africa and the United Kingdom, typically loaded in 20‑ft or 40‑ft containers on bulk pallets, with certificates of origin and FSSAI approval. Seafood such as pomfret and mud crab are sent to the GCC and EU markets, necessitating HACCP audit reports, health certificates and ice‑packed transport. Sunflower oil and refined sugar (ICUMSA 45) are shipped in bulk or drums to African and Asian buyers, with ISO 22000 or equivalent food‑safety certifications commonly requested. Standard Incoterms used by Indian exporters include FOB and CIF, and packaging standards range from vacuum‑sealed cartons for fruits to wooden crates for fish and bulk bags for rice.
Sourcing from Dileeparun Impex Pvt Ltd - Buyer Guidance
When sourcing from Dileeparun Impex Pvt Ltd, buyers should request a product specification sheet that includes size grading, moisture content, pesticide‑residue test results and, where applicable, microbiological analysis for seafood. Verification of FSSAI registration, ISO 22000 or HACCP audit reports, and a phytosanitary certificate is advisable for all fresh produce and marine items. Packaging details - such as refrigerated container availability for apples and pomfret, crate dimensions for fish, and 20 kg bag specifications for basmati rice - should be confirmed before order confirmation. Typical minimum order quantities are 2‑5 metric tons for fresh fruits, 5‑10 metric tons for rice and wheat, and 1‑2 metric tons for seafood, with lead times ranging from 15 to 30 days depending on seasonality and product type.
